Boat Specifications

LOA:14.61 m / 47.93 ft
Rigging Type:Masthead Ketch
Hull Type:Long Keel
S.A. (reported):109.81 m2 / 1181.99 ft2
Draft (max):1.83 m / 6.00 ft
Displacement:14061 kg / 30999.16 lbs
Ballast:5897 kg / 13000.64 lbs
S.A./Disp.:19.24
Bal./Disp.:41.94
Disp./Len.:352.11
Construction:FG
# Built:20
Designers:Alfred E. Luders
LWL:10.36 m / 33.99 ft
